What Are HPL Sheets?
HPL (High Pressure Laminate) sheets are decorative and protective panels created by pressing layers of kraft paper with resins under high pressure and temperature.

2. Ventilated Facades
Modern high-rises use ventilated facade systems to improve energy efficiency. HPL sheets integrate seamlessly into these systems, reducing cooling costs.
